Uganda U-18 Women’s Football Team to Face Burundi in Must-Win Game

by Geoffrey Mugabi
1 minutes read

The Uganda U-18 Women’s Football Team will be in action after 4 days of resting as they take on Burundi in a must-win game to keep their hopes of winning the title alive.

The game will be played at 6pm at Azam Complex, and will be the third game for Uganda in the tournament.

Uganda defeated Ethiopia 1-0 in the opening game before beating Zanzibar 3-0 in the second game.

Coach Ayub Khalifah has made it clear that their target is to win every game and lift the title.

“We have rested enough since we last played and this has given us enough time to work on the grey areas.”

“Therefore, as we go into the game against Burundi, we hope for the best because victory gives us a chance to go into the final game against Tanzania with fate in our hands,” he said.

Khalifah also states that they have tried to work on the mentality of the players so that they remain focused.

“Staying in one place for a long time can bring mental fatigue but we have tried to keep the players focused on our mission and they have so far responded positively,” he concluded.

Uganda is currently second on the table, 3 points and 2 goals behind Tanzania. The other game of the day will see winless Zanzibar face Ethiopia.

The last game of the tournament will see hosts Tanzania face Uganda in an encounter that is expected to be the title decider.

The CECAFA U-18 Women’s Championship is a round-robin tournament, with the team with the most points at the end of the tournament being crowned champions.
